Multan Gets new Telenor Sales and Services Center!
Telenor Pakistan has started a new Sales and Service Center in Multan today (18th July 2011) on Abdali road. Four franchises will be supported by this S&SC and it will also cover area from khanewal, Kabirwala, Bahawalpur and Khanpur to Muzaffargarh and Lodhran.
Fake Mobile Scratch Cards Cause Rs 134m loss to Telecom Companies
Apart from other crimes taking place in Pakistan, the fraud and theft cases in the Telecommunication industry witnessed in the recent past are gaining roots day by day. Recently it is revealed that many fake mobile cards of different companies were made by some criminals which resulted in a total loss of Rs 134 million to various mobile companies in Pakistan.
